Giáo án link (giaoan.link) chia sẻ đến các bạn một project về Google sheet App Script, Copy data From Sheet to Sheet with Conditions – Thỏa điều kiện. Khi thỏa một điều kiện vùng dữ liệu sẽ được sao chép qua một sheet mới.
Xem các project excel ứng dụng khác:
- Google sheet Webapp|Giáo viên chủ nhiệm quản lý điểm, thống kê xếp hạng chia sẻ cho phụ huynh
- Google sheet Webapp | Bản nâng cấp Tìm và Load Thông tin sinh viên có Hình ảnh và Bảng kết quả thi
- Google webapp | Form tìm, hiển thị kết quả học tập nhiều môn và in phiếu kết quả
- Danh mục các Bài học Google sheet Apps script Cơ bản
- Bản Nâng cấp Hệ thống hóa đơn Phân quyền Quản lý khách Quản lý sản phẩm Quản lý hóa đơn
- Tạo webapp import và update dữ liệu từ Excel lên Google sheet có Load bảng Table lên nền tảng web
- Google sheet, appscript và webapp – Giải pháp thu hoạc phí toàn diện
- Quản Lý Học Phí Bằng Google Apps Script: Form CRUD, Tìm Kiếm, In Phiếu Thu và Tự Động Tính Toán
- Giảm dung lượng PDF dễ dàng với PDF24 Creator – Miễn phí và hiệu quả
- Chuyển đổi Pdf dạng bản scan sang MS Excel chuẩn không bị lỗi font và giữ nguyên định dạng
Mã code Apps Script
function onOpen(){
let ui=SpreadsheetApp.getUi();
ui.createMenu('Custom menu')
.addItem('Copy Rows','copyRows')
.addToUi();
}
function copyRows(){
var sourceSheet = SpreadsheetApp.getActiveSpreadsheet().getSheetByName('Data');
var targetSheet = SpreadsheetApp.getActiveSpreadsheet().getSheetByName('Data1');
var dataRange = sourceSheet.getDataRange();
var dataValues = dataRange.getValues();
for(var i = 1; i<dataValues.length;i++){
if(dataValues[i][3]==="X"){
targetSheet.appendRow([dataValues[i][0],
dataValues[i][1],
dataValues[i][2]
]);
}
}
}
